It's not just an October thing. No, here in Los Angeles, we start preparing for Halloween during November of the year before - but it's not just our home haunts, special effects make-up expertise and elaborate costuming that makes L.A. particularly creeptastic all year long.
It's our proximity to and unusual comfort with the scarier side of nature - owls, snakes, tarantulas, and the like. It's the blurred line between fantasy and reality that places us in that no man's land between a dream state and being awake - where we're not sure if we're remembering something that actually happened, or whether we saw it in a movie or read it in a script.
Of course, we've also got our fair share of hauntings - but rather than fleeing from the dead and the undead, we've learned to embrace it all. Here are six great examples of places that help make the City of Angels more like Spooksville, U.S.A.
1. Dapper Cadaver, Sun Valley
This is a busy time of year for Dapper Cadaver, the horror props house by the Burbank Airport that sells and rents anything from coffins to aliens, dinosaurs, and incredibly realistic-looking-but-fake corpses. It gets a lot of its business from Hollywood, but it also supplies the creators of home haunts as well as collectors of oddities like vintage surgical instruments, skulls and other bones, and jars of preserved critters (some fake, but some real). In fact, their work is so good that it can be difficult to tell the difference between a prop and a specimen - although you'd be safe to assume that there aren't any actual dead bodies in their showroom. But catch one of their glassy-eyed, disembodied heads out of the corner of your eye, and you're likely to jump a little. Dapper Cadaver is open to the public during the week all year round, but in October you can also visit on Saturday for that fake goat or stone archangel you've been meaning to get for your yard.

2. Skeletons in the Closet, Lincoln Park
You probably wouldn't expect any coroners office to have a gift shop - but at the County of Los Angeles Department of Medical Examiner-Coroner, that's exactly what you'll find. Just walk through the front door of the former Los Angeles General Hospital administration building on the LAC+USC Medical Center campus, check in with security on your left, and enter Skeletons in the Closet on your right. You'll find garment body bags, crime scene beach towels, chalk outline welcome mats, coffee mugs, keychains, mousepads, and even toe tags. Although there's a fair amount of levity to many of their product offerings, it shouldn't detract from the serious business of the coroner's office. In operation since 1993, the store's mission is to promote how fragile life is and create awareness and responsibility toward ones actions. But if you visit in person, it's also a good way to give yourself the heebie-jeebies inside a building that you otherwise wouldn't wish to visit.

3. Bearded Lady Vintage & Oddities and Bearded Lady's Mystic Museum, Burbank
Ever wish that your antiques store sold medical equipment? Or that there was somewhere to get your crazy cat lady friend a black cat Ouija board? Have you ever been to an artwalk and thought that there just weren't enough ghosts in the galleries? Well, it's your lucky day, because Burbank's Bearded Lady has got all of that and more, between its two locations just two blocks way from each other on Magnolia. The Vintage & Oddities shop is more of a traditional shopping experience with a dark twist, while the more recently-opened Mystic Museum down the street features a shop of new oddball gifts in the front and a museum / art gallery / event space in the back. The art on the wall switches out regularly, but there's also a permanent collection of vintage occult paraphernalia, including an impressive collection of spirit boards. Special events hosted in the museum include s ances, magic shows, and sideshow acts. Both shops are conveniently located a short distance from the Halloweentown year-round horror headquarters, the horror specialty bookstore Dark Delicacies, and the dark-leaning, monster-friendly collectibles and comics shop Creature Features.

4. Necromance, Hollywood
There are those who enjoy the delicious spookiness of fantasy, and others who prefer the terrifying truth of real life. With its collection of bug, bones and skeletons, and sea creatures and shells (some of which have been made into jewelry), Necromance can definitely satisfy your curiosity of the natural history and wonders of this earthly realm. You can get one-of-a-kind poison bottles, freeze-dried and taxidermied rodents, and a real contemporary medical bone saw. Some of the items in their retail collection veer towards the occult - shrunken heads, crystals, beads, and various talismans - but by and large, the items here prove that truth can be stranger than fiction. Prices range from $1 to $150+, so when you go, buy a little something rather than just window shopping or taking photos.
